[QUOTE="Cheyenne 1, post: 1052908, member: 9735"] This summer I was in a store in Minnesota not too far from where Fedral brass is made. I was taking to the owner about brass, quality and availabilty of it. We were discussing Nosler brass and he told me that a few people that worked in the Federal plant said they made the Nosler brass. That was directly from employees at the plant. He said that it was made on a different line and obviously it was weight sorted, flash holes cleaned and chamfered. He never said if it was made of differnt alloys or not. I had alway heard that Nosler brass was made by Norma but this was always just stories. So after hearing directly from employees of federal I would tend to belive them. [/QUOTE]
